NYC Emergency Management (NYCEM) coordinates the City's response to natural and human-made emergencies. NYCEM acknowledges that communities of color and low-income communities are disproportionately impacted by emergencies and disasters. NYCEM's equity goals address centering equity in emergency preparedness, response, and recovery; expanding language access in emergency communications; building community resilience in TRIE neighborhoods; and ensuring that emergency resources reach the most vulnerable communities (consistent with Community Equity Priority #12).
